Biography

Mary Vaughan was born on 26 Nov 1755 in Lebanon, New London County, Connecticut Colony. Her parents were Capt. John S Vaughan and Anne Beebe.[1]

Birth Records

Primary Source: "Connecticut Marriages, 1640-1939," database with images, FamilySearch (https://familysearch.org/ark:/61903/1:1:QLM7-DZ1F : 11 April 2017), Beebe in entry for Daniel, Birth 1753, New London, New London, Connecticut, United States; Connecticut State Library, Hartford; FHL microfilm 1,312,154. [ Original document Anne (Beebe) Vaughan)]
Document Summary: the following New London, New London, Conn. vital records for Anne (Beebe) Vaughan are cited:
1) John Vaughan and Anne Beebe were married together on 31 June 1752. (He says).
2) Daniel Vaughan ye son was born 11 Jan 1753.
3) Mary their daughter was born 26 Nov 1755.
4) Anne their daughter ws born 18 Sep 1757.
5) Martha their daughter was born 11 Feb 1759.
